Here we introduce C-shaped steel, which consists of a web plate, upper and lower flanges, and rolled edges; Curling edge is the core design, greatly improving bending and torsion resistance, and avoiding flange buckling; Hot dip galvanizing/zinc aluminum magnesium anti-corrosion is commonly used outdoors, and black material can be used indoors. Follow the GB/T 6725 cold-formed steel standard.

Advantages and Differences
Advantages
Lightweight and high-strength, standardized production, length adjustable, anti-corrosion optional hot-dip galvanizing/zinc aluminum magnesium, suitable for harsh outdoor environments such as coastal and desert areas, lower cost than aluminum alloy brackets, suitable for large-scale ground/roof photovoltaic projects.
Difference: C-shaped steel
Cold-formed, with rolled edges, high precision, suitable for light to medium load-bearing; Mostly used in the 41/60/80 series for photovoltaics.
Difference: Hot rolled channel steel
Formed by hot rolling, without rolled edges, uneven wall thickness, and heavy weight; Mostly used for heavy-duty structural beams and columns.
